    Buhari declares Zamfara no-fly-zone, bans mining activities

    President Muhammadu Buhari has approved the imposition and enforcement of a BAN on ALL mining activities in Zamfara State, with immediate effect, until further notice.

     

    The President has also approved that Zamfara State be declared a No-Fly-Zone with immediate effect.

    National Security Adviser, Maj Gen Babagana Monguno (rtd) disclosed this to State House correspondents on Tuesday after a five hour security council meeting presided over by President Buhari at the presidential Villa, Abuja.

     

    A no-fly zone, also known as a no-flight zone, or air exclusion zone, is a territory or area established by a military power over which certain aircraft are not permitted to fly.

     

    The NSA said the country’s defence and intelligence organization have been put on alert and charged not to allow the country to slide into a state of anarchy.

     

    Monguno also said the president, in the meeting, gave a marching order to the new service chiefs to reclaim all areas under the control by bandits, insurgents and kidnappers.

     

    “We are not going to be blackmailed. The government has the responsibility to assert its will,” Monguno said.

     

    “Citizens can reside wherever they want to reside. Anybody who is a criminal should be brought to book.

     

    “The president has also warned against ethnic profiling. We have enough of chaos.

     

    “Any individual that thinks he can cause disunity should have a rethink.”

     

    The governor after the meeting told journalists at the presidential villa that he was summoned by the President to brief him on the security situation in his state.

     

    Mattawalle added that 358 special police forces have been deployed by the Federal Government to the state to tackle banditry.

    General Monguno also stated that all non-state actors have been placed under surveillance as the Federal Government will not hesitate to use kinetic means to restore normalcy in the country.
